Chic in Batik

Thrifted dress, Urban Outfitters cuff, Antique Indian earrings, Zigi Girl Wedges via DSW
I bought this batik dress at a thrift store near the beginning of summer, and I wasn't sure I would wear it much since it isn't the most figure-flattering with its billowing silhouette, but at three dollars, I thought it wouldn't hurt to give it a try.  After all, I've always loved batik, a Javanese dyeing technique, and as it turns out, I actually do want a dress that doesn't restrict my waist for those weeks when my exercise routine has fallen off and I've scarfed down  a few too many pita chips.  Bringing sexy back?  Not exactly.  Bringing the muumuu back? I'm trying!
